Venetian Painted and Parcel-Gilt Oak Armchair, Ex. Estate of Hilary Knight

Item Details

The chair, covered in printed star velour, was decorated by Hilary Knight, and was a gift from Kay Thompson. She only gave him two thirds of the chair and asked him to pay the remaining third, just like their contract for ‘Eloise’. Included with this lot is a copy of ‘Eloise’ signed by Hilary Knight.
